What Drives Pricing Differences

Model size and capability tier, input vs. output token pricing (output is often priced higher), and whether a model is open-weight (self-hosted, no per-token fee) or closed (managed API with per-token billing) all factor into the price you actually pay.

Why is output token pricing often higher than input?

Generating text is generally more computationally intensive than processing input, which is reflected in most providers' pricing structures.

Is open-weight always cheaper than a closed API?

Often yes at scale, though you need to factor in your own infrastructure cost if self-hosting rather than using a managed API.
